Part 1: Must-Visit Landmarks

Rainbow 6 (Exit 6)
The vibrant symbol of Taiwan's inclusivity. Located right outside Exit 6, it's the perfect spot for your "I'm in Taipei" photo.
Meaning: Celebrating equality and love win spirit. ✨

The Red House (西門紅樓)
Built in 1908, this red-brick landmark is a witness to Taipei's history and now a hub for creative local designs.
⚠️ Reminder: Closed every Monday!
Part 2: The Taste of Ximending

Ay-Chung Flour-Rice Noodle
Famous for its smoky broth and chewy intestines. Be prepared to stand and eat with the crowd!

Xing Fu Tang Bubble Tea
Watch them stir-fry brown sugar pearls live! Don't forget to try their signature pearls and soup dumplings.

🍹 Chengdu Starfruit Ice
A local favorite for decades. If you’re sweating from the heat, this sweet, tangy, and slightly salty ice drink is the ultimate thirst quencher.
Part 3: Cool Vibes & Hidden Gems

🕸️ Graffiti Lane (American Street)
Duck into the alleys near American Street and Cinema Park to find massive murals showcasing Taipei’s free-spirited energy.

🎮 Wan Nian Building
Nostalgic "otaku" heaven! If you love anime, collectibles, or retro sneakers, this building is your paradise.
